For homeowners in Columbia, choosing Trex Decks is a solid decision due to our humid summers and occasional winter freezes. Unlike wood, Trex composite material is engineered to resist moisture absorption, preventing issues like rot, warping, and splintering that are common with traditional lumber in our local climate. This resilience means less time spent on staining or sealing and more time enjoying your outdoor space, which is very appealing given the year-round outdoor living opportunities here.

Many homeowners inquire about the installation process for Trex Decks and how it differs from wood. While the substructure is similar, composite decking requires specific fastening techniques and attention to expansion and contraction, especially in our temperature swings. Trex Decks offer significant advantages for homes in Columbia, SC, because of their exceptional durability and low maintenance requirements. The local climate in Columbia, SC, features hot summers, high humidity, and heavy rainfall. These weather conditions can be very harsh on traditional wood decks, leading to wood rot, mildew growth, and fading. Trex Decks are engineered to resist these environmental challenges. Trex Decks maintain their appearance and structural integrity without the constant need for staining, sealing, or painting.

Long-term cost savings are also a major factor for Columbia homeowners. While the initial investment for Trex Decks might be higher than traditional pressure-treated wood, the absence of annual maintenance costs quickly offsets this difference. Over the lifespan of Trex Decks, homeowners save money on materials, labor, and the time they would otherwise spend on upkeep. For residents in Columbia, SC, Trex Decks provide a financially sound choice for those looking for a lasting outdoor solution.

Pioneer Deck Solutions notes that Trex Decking is made from 95 percent recycled materials, including reclaimed wood and plastic film, making it an environmentally responsible choice. A properly installed Trex Decks system can last 25 to 30 years or more in the Columbia climate. Trex Decks often exceed the lifespan of traditional wood decks in Columbia, SC. Trex composite materials are specifically engineered to resist rot, insect damage, and moisture absorption that can shorten the life of wood in the humid environment of Columbia. The manufacturer warranty typically covers fading, staining, and material defects for decades. For homes and businesses in Columbia, Pioneer Deck Solutions provides Trex Decks services.
Trex Decks can get hotter than traditional wood decking when exposed to direct Columbia sun, especially when you choose darker colors. However, Trex offers cooler-to-the-touch options like their Trex Enhance Naturals and Trex Transcend Lineage collections, which are designed with heat-mitigating technology. Choosing lighter colors and ensuring adequate ventilation beneath the deck can also help manage surface temperatures, making the space more comfortable during our hot Columbia summers. Trex Decks require very little maintenance compared to traditional wood decks here in Columbia, SC. Pioneer Deck Solutions builds Trex Decks so that homeowners do not need to stain, seal, or paint the surface annually. The primary maintenance for Trex Decks involves periodic cleaning with mild soap and water to remove dirt, pollen, and mildew that can accumulate due to the local humidity in Columbia. For tougher spots, a pressure washer on a low setting can be used on Trex Decks. Keeping Trex Decks clear of fallen leaves and debris and making sure there is good airflow underneath the structure will help maintain the appearance and longevity of Trex Decks for 15 to 20 years or more. Permits are typically required for building a new Trex deck or significantly altering an existing one in Columbia, SC. The City of Columbia building department has specific requirements for deck construction, including structural integrity, railing height, and setback distances.
